Frequently Asked Questions about Palm Beach County
What type of rentals are currently available in Palm Beach County?
There are currently 3277 Apartments for Rent in Palm Beach County, FL with pricing that ranges from $675 to $65,000. There are also 6975 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Palm Beach County ranging from $600 to $100,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Palm Beach County?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Palm Beach County ranges from $600 to $100,000 with an average monthly rent of $13,723.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Palm Beach County?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Palm Beach County range from $1,300 to $65,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$950 to $80,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,899 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,504.
